A Controller for the Smart Home

Control4’s HC-300 home controller serves as a central building block for a smart home, replacing up to four remote controls with a single remote built around a simple interface. The controller offers multiple infrared and serial connections along with video sensing for simple home theater integration. Supported communications technologies include Ethernet, WiFi, and ZigBee mesh networking via USB. The HC-300 controls home theater, multi-room music, smart lighting, security, and HVAC systems. Beefed-up processing power allows for efficient operation of large media databases. An HD onscreen output boosts the quality of the graphic interface.
